sched: Fix migration thread runtime bogosity
commit 8f6189684eb4e85e6c593cd710693f09c944450a upstream. Make stop scheduler class do the same accounting as other classes, Migration threads can be caught in the act while doing exec balancing, leading to the below due to use of unmaintained ->se.exec_start.
